I was working around the house and thought I would pop in this DVD while I get some things done. This has got to be the most well-made and entertaining comedy ever made (shields up Spartans!).
First saw this back in the 70s. A sheer gut-shaking, belly-quaking classic. I don't know which one is the race scene I enjoy the most, but here are some; big Jonathan Winters wrecking down the "new" gas station, Jim Backus flying his personal plane with Mickey and Buddy, Sid Caesar & wife blowing up the basement hardware store, Phil Silvers losing his car in the river, or Dick Shawn racing his convertible across the highway to rescue his "mama" (Ethel Merman). Not to mention all of the special cameos :yes:
Okay, it's intermission, time to go back to work & laugh.:D

And Kudos to Stanley Kramer for this 2 hr and 41 minute laugh fest.
